Technical Field
[0001] This utility model relates to the field of rice processing technology, specifically to a sampling inspection device for rice processing. Background Technology
[0002] Quality control is a crucial aspect of rice production. To ensure that the produced rice meets quality standards, manufacturers typically conduct random sampling inspections of the bagged rice. Sampling inspection is a method that involves randomly selecting samples from rice bags and then observing the samples to confirm whether the rice quality meets the prescribed standards.
[0003] Chinese patent document CN202323242269.4 discloses a rice sampling device. When used, a user opens a sealed plug and places a sample of rice into a storage bottle. The user can adjust the position of the limiting rod according to the required quantity of rice to be sampled, helping to quickly identify the volume of the sampled rice. The user can rotate the anti-slip cap, causing the lead screw to rotate and the screw sleeve to move vertically. This, in turn, drives the corresponding limiting rod to adjust its height via the connecting block and the limiting block. The user can obtain the appropriate quantity of rice by looking through the transparent plastic storage bottle and using a ruler in conjunction with the height of the limiting rod. Finally, the sample is sealed... The stopper ensures the sealing of the inner cavity of the storage bottle. The setting of the limiting rod makes it easy for personnel to see from top to bottom whether the amount of rice inside the storage bottle meets the sampling requirements. The outer shell protects its internal structure from external forces. The storage bottle is made of transparent plastic, and personnel can see the amount of rice inside through the outer wall of the storage bottle. The setting of the screw makes it easy for personnel to control the displacement direction of the screw sleeve. The setting of the anti-slip cap reduces the probability of the screw sleeve slipping when personnel turn it. The setting of the through groove, together with the connecting block, prevents the screw sleeve from rotating on its own. Through the structural design, personnel can quickly and accurately control the sampling quantity of rice during the sampling inspection process.
[0004] Regarding the aforementioned technologies, the inventors believe the following drawbacks exist: The device's outer shell is rectangular with sharp edges and corners, and the limiting rod protrudes beyond the surface of the storage bottle. When the operator holds the device, their palm directly contacts the edges and corners of the outer shell and the protruding part of the limiting rod, creating stress concentration points. Especially during high-frequency sampling inspections, repeated pressure on the edges can easily lead to fatigue and even abrasions. The limiting rod is fixedly connected to the connecting block via a limiting block, and the bottom of the lead screw relies on a rotating shaft, while the top passes through the outer shell via a bushing. This fixed connection method results in a high degree of integration of the adjustment mechanism and cumbersome disassembly steps. When problems such as lead screw jamming or limiting rod wear occur after long-term use, it is necessary to remove the outer shell, separate the connecting block and the limiting block, and even disassemble the rotating shaft or bushing, consuming a lot of time and tools. Therefore, a sampling inspection device for rice processing is proposed to solve the above problems. Utility Model Content
[0005] The main objective of this invention is to provide a sampling inspection device for rice processing, which solves the problems mentioned in the background art.
[0006] To achieve the above objectives, this utility model provides the following technical solution: a sampling inspection device for rice processing, comprising a storage bottle and a sealing plug, wherein a first arc-shaped block is provided on the storage bottle, a second arc-shaped block is rotatably mounted on the end of the first arc-shaped block, and a limit adjustment mechanism is provided on the storage bottle;
[0007] The limit adjustment includes setting a plug and a slot. The first arc-shaped block has a slot inside. The end of the second arc-shaped block is fixed with a plug that slides with the slot. The plug has a slot. A fixing box is fixed to the outside of the end of the first arc-shaped block. A plug rod is slidably installed in the fixing box. A baffle is fixed on the plug rod. A spring is sleeved on the plug rod. A locking block that engages with the slot is fixed on one side of the baffle.
[0008] Furthermore, the ends of both the card block and the insertion block are trapezoidal, and a through groove for the card block to slide is provided in the first arc-shaped block.
[0009] Furthermore, the two ends of the spring are respectively fixed to the side wall of the baffle and the bottom wall of the inner side of the fixed box.
[0010] Furthermore, both the first and second arc-shaped blocks are threaded with threaded rods, and a clamping block is rotatably mounted at the end of the threaded rod.
[0011] Furthermore, the inner sidewalls of both the first and second arc-shaped blocks are provided with storage grooves for storing the clamping blocks.
[0012] Furthermore, the limiting adjustment includes multiple grooves formed on the outside of the storage bottle, with a rubber pad fixed in the groove, the surface of the rubber pad being flush with the outside of the storage bottle.
[0013] Compared with the prior art, the technical solution of this application has the following beneficial effects:
[0014] This sampling inspection device for rice processing features a limit adjustment mechanism. The first and second arc-shaped blocks are quickly engaged via inserts, slots, and spring-driven locking blocks. Operators can adjust the height of the second arc-shaped block simply by pushing it. The threaded rods within the first and second arc-shaped blocks can extend the clamping block, adapting to storage bottles of different diameters or fixing it to the testing equipment. Rotating the threaded rods quickly locks the limit position, meeting the quantitative needs of diverse sampling scenarios. The sliding fit between the inserts and slots, and the separate design of the locking block and slot, allow for quick disassembly of the first and second arc-shaped blocks (simply press the insert to disengage the locking block from the slot), eliminating the need for tools to separate the limit adjustment mechanism. The wraparound structure formed by the first and second arc-shaped blocks conforms to the natural curvature of the palm, replacing the angular design of traditional rectangular shells. This ensures even pressure distribution in the palm during grip, preventing discomfort during prolonged operation, while the rubber pad further increases grip friction. Attached Figure Description

[0022] Please see Figure 1-5 This embodiment of a sampling inspection device for rice processing includes a storage bottle 1 and a sealing plug 2. A first arc-shaped block 301 is provided on the storage bottle 1, and a second arc-shaped block 302 is rotatably mounted on the end of the first arc-shaped block 301. A limit adjustment mechanism 3 is provided on the storage bottle 1, and scale lines are provided on the outer side of the storage bottle 1.
[0023] The limit adjustment includes setting a plug 309 and a slot 311. The slot 311 is opened inside the first arc-shaped block 301. The end of the second arc-shaped block 302 is fixed with a plug 309 that slides with the slot 311. The plug 309 is provided with a slot 310. A fixing box 303 is fixed to the outer side of the end of the first arc-shaped block 301. A plug rod 308 is slidably installed in the fixing box 303. A baffle 313 is fixed on the plug rod 308. A spring 314 is sleeved on the plug rod 308. A locking block 312 that engages with the slot 310 is fixed on one side of the baffle 313.
[0024] The inner sidewalls of the first arc-shaped block 301 and the second arc-shaped block 302 are provided with storage slots 315 for storing the clamping block 305.
[0025] The limit adjustment includes multiple grooves 307 on the outside of the storage bottle 1. A rubber pad 306 is fixed in the groove 307. The anti-slip structure of the rubber pad 306 improves the stability and comfort when holding the bottle and reduces operating fatigue. The surface of the rubber pad 306 is flush with the outside of the storage bottle 1. A storage groove 315 is opened on the inner wall of the arc-shaped block. When the clamping block 305 retracts with the threaded rod 304, it is completely embedded in the storage groove 315, so that the inner wall of the arc-shaped block remains flat.
[0026] The operator pushes the second arc-shaped block 302 to rotate around the rotating connection point, causing the insert block 309 to insert into the slot 311 of the first arc-shaped block 301. The trapezoidal end of the insert block 309 presses against the locking block 312, forcing the locking block 312 to retract into the fixed box 303 against the force of the spring 314. When the insert block 309 is fully inserted into the slot 311, the locking block 312 aligns with the slot 310 of the insert block 309, and the spring 314 resets, pushing the locking block 312 into the slot 310, fixing the first and second arc-shaped blocks 302 into one unit, forming a ring-shaped limiting position for the storage bottle 1. Conversely, pulling the insert rod 308 causes the baffle 313 and the locking block 312 to retract, releasing the locking block 312 from the slot 310, allowing the second arc-shaped block 302 to be rotated to adjust the limiting position.
[0027] Both the locking block 312 and the insert block 309 have trapezoidal ends. The first arc-shaped block 301 has a through groove for the locking block 312 to slide. The trapezoidal structure can guide the locking block 312 to automatically align when the insert block 309 is inserted. The through groove provides a sliding guide for the locking block 312, ensuring a smooth and uninterrupted locking process. When the trapezoidal end of the insert block 309 contacts the locking block 312, the inclined surface generates a horizontal component force, pushing the locking block 312 to slide along the through groove into the fixing box 303. No manual alignment is required, reducing the difficulty of operation. When the insert block 309 is in place, the locking block 312 pops out along the through groove under the force of the spring 314. The trapezoidal locking block 312 and the inclined surface of the locking groove 310 fit tightly together, eliminating the fit gap and ensuring that the limiting position is stable and does not loosen.
[0028] Meanwhile, the two ends of the spring 314 are fixed to the side wall of the baffle 313 and the inner bottom wall of the fixed box 303 respectively. The elastic reset structure driven by the spring 314 ensures the stable engagement of the card block 312 and the card slot 310, and avoids accidental unlocking.
[0029] In addition, threaded rods 304 are threadedly connected to both the first arc-shaped block 301 and the second arc-shaped block 302. A clamping block 305 is rotatably installed at the end of the threaded rod 304. The position of the clamping block 305 can be adjusted by adjusting the threaded rod 304 to clamp and fix the storage bottle 1 or adapt it to external devices, thus expanding the application scenarios of the device.
[0030] The working principle of the above embodiments is as follows:
[0031] When in use, personnel open the sealing plug 2 and then put the sampled rice into the storage bottle 1. Personnel can adjust the position of the first arc block 301 and the second arc block 302 according to the actual amount of rice to be sampled, which helps personnel quickly identify the volume of the sampled rice.
[0032] The operator holds the storage bottle 1 and pushes the second arc-shaped block 302 around its rotational connection point with the first arc-shaped block 301 with their thumb. This aligns the insert 309 at the end of the second arc-shaped block 302 with the slot 311 inside the first arc-shaped block 301. When the trapezoidal end of the insert 309 contacts the locking block 312 inside the outer fixing box 303 of the first arc-shaped block 301, the inclined surface pushes the locking block 312 to slide along the through groove into the fixing box 303. When the insert 309 is fully inserted into the slot 311 and the locking block 312 aligns with the locking groove 310 of the insert 309, the spring 314 returns to its original position, releasing its elastic force and pushing the baffle 313 and the locking block 312 into the locking groove 310, thus fixing the first and second arc-shaped blocks 302 together to form a circumferential limiting position for the storage bottle 1. At this time, the position of the arc-shaped block corresponds to the sampling volume scale on the storage bottle 1.
[0033] In conjunction with the rotating threaded rods 304 within the first and second arc-shaped blocks 302, the clamping block 305 at the drive end extends from the storage groove 315. The anti-slip texture or flexible material on the surface of the clamping block 305 adheres to the rubber pad 306 on the outer wall of the storage bottle 1, achieving secondary reinforcement through the self-locking force of the threads. There are no protruding parts on the outer side of the arc-shaped blocks, avoiding the risk of hand wear caused by the protrusion of traditional outer shells.
[0034] When cleaning or replacement of parts is required, pull the insert rod 308 on the outside of the fixed box 303. This will cause the baffle 313 and the locking block 312 to retract against the force of the spring 314, releasing the locking block 312 from the locking slot 310 of the insert block 309. At this time, the second arc-shaped block 302 can be rotated directly to separate the insert block 309 from the slot 311. The arc-shaped block assembly can be disassembled without tools to clean the accumulated rice dust or replace the worn spring 314 and locking block 312.
